Durllabhpur Village - Kushmundi, Dakshin Dinajpur

Durllabhpur is a village situated in the Kushmundi subdivision of Dakshin Dinajpur district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 14.7 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kushmundi and around 92.2 km from the district headquarters in Balurghat. Maligaon serves as the Gram Panchayat for Durllabhp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Durllabhpur is 310559. The village covers a total geographical area of 90.6 hectares and falls under the 733132 pincode. Kaliyaganj is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.

Durllabhp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Durllabhpur

As per Census 2011, Durllabhpur village has a total population of 516 people, consisting of 265 males and 251 females. The village has 127 households and a sex ratio of 947 females per 1,000 males. There are 67 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 229 literate and 287 illiterate residents. Additionally, 187 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 307 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Durllabhpur

Public transport facilities are available within <1 km of the Durllabhpur. The nearest railway station is Gangarampur, while the nearest airport is Balurghat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 30.3 km.
